Michael G. Edison, Esq.

Partner

     Michael George Edison, Esq. is the Founding and Managing Partner of Edison & Edison, PLLC, a Florida-based law firm focused on business, real estate, construction, and contract law. He advises entrepreneurs, property owners, and closely held companies throughout the Tampa Bay region on transactional, regulatory, and dispute-related matters, bringing a practical and principled approach to legal problem-solving.


      Michael’s professional perspective is shaped by a unique blend of private legal practice and public service. Prior to becoming an attorney, he served as a Detective and Deputy Sheriff with the Polk County Sheriff’s Office, where he worked in narcotics investigations, organized crime, and crime suppression units. His law enforcement background continues to inform his disciplined, compliance-focused approach to governance, risk management, and organizational leadership.


     Committed to education and the preparation of future public servants, Michael serves as an adjunct professor at Hillsborough College’s Law Enforcement Academy. In this role, he teaches legal curriculum to law enforcement recruits, including constitutional law, criminal procedure, statutory interpretation, and officer liability.


     Michael is deeply involved in community and nonprofit service in East Hillsborough County. He serves on the Board of Directors of the Valrico FishHawk Chamber of Commerce,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it dedicated to strengthening local businesses and community engagement, and on the Board of Directors of Graze Academy, Inc., a 501(c)(3) nonprofit focused on equine-assisted therapy and community wellness. He also serves on the Brandon Parade of Lights Committee, supporting local traditions and charitable fundraising efforts.


       A God-fearing Christian, devoted husband, and father of four, Michael places faith, family, and service at the center of his life. He and his wife homeschool their children and live on a small cattle ranch in Central Florida, continuing a lifelong connection to agriculture, stewardship, and hard work. He is a proud patriot who values service to God, family, and country.


    Michael earned his Juris Doctor, cum laude, from Western Michigan University Thomas M. Cooley Law School and holds a Bachelor of Arts in Criminal Justice from Saint Leo University. He is admitted to practice in Florida and the United States District Court for the Middle District of Florida.
